Epilepsy surgery in infancy. A review of four cases

Early surgical intervention for intractable pediatric seizures can lead to dramatic recovery. Resection of the epileptogenic focus in infants significantly improved seizure control, with some becoming seizure-free.

Background:

  • Intractable seizures in infants often present significant challenges to management.
  • Surgical resection of the epileptogenic zone is a recognized treatment for refractory epilepsy.
  • Limited data exists on early surgical intervention in very young infants.

Observation:

  • This study reviewed 4 infants (5-9 months old) with severe, intractable seizures unresponsive to anticonvulsants.
  • All infants underwent pre-operative EEG and MRI; 2 had PET imaging.
  • Surgical procedures included temporal resection for glioma and cortical resections for malformations/dysplasia.

Findings:

  • All 4 infants demonstrated improvement in seizure control post-operatively.
  • Two infants achieved complete seizure freedom off all anti-epileptic medications.
  • Surgical intervention led to significant positive outcomes in this cohort.

Implications:

  • Early surgical intervention should be strongly considered for infants with severe, intractable epilepsy.
  • Prompt treatment can lead to dramatic recovery and improved long-term neurological outcomes.
  • This approach offers a promising alternative for managing pediatric refractory seizures.
